The flaky tests in paysvc-integration mostly stem from the Lumenpay sandbox resetting idempotency windows every hour. Retry the suite once before flagging a PR; if card-capture tests fail twice, the sandbox is likely mid-reset. Quarantined tests live in tests/flaky.list and must not grow without review. To run the suite locally against the Lumenpay sandbox, use the key below.

service key, fawip-bajef: kto11_Qt5wZK9vdNC

// MAX_IMPORT_BATCH caps records per pass of the Shelfwright
// catalogue import. Raised from 500 after the Bindery vendor
// feed tripled in size; higher values stall the dedupe stage.
// Do not touch without rerunning the Quillmark soak test.
// For the sync: this constant last changed in the build whose
// token appears below.

session token of fafof-bahof = htk9_cde2d95fb

Handover — Gatepulse turnstile counter, Harrowfen Arena

Counts drifted last night: gate C sensors double-fire when fans push through together. Dedup window bumped from 150ms to 400ms; watch for undercounting at peak ingress. Reconciliation job runs at 02:00 and emails ops if variance exceeds 2%. Don't restart the aggregator mid-event — it drops the in-memory window and you'll never reconcile. If the venue calls about occupancy alarms, check the stale-sensor list first. The service is currently running with these configuration values.

settings of kajep-kajop:
OLIDOR_LOG_LEVEL=info
OLIDOR_METRICS_HOST=metrics.olidor.norvacorp.corp
OLIDOR_POOL_SIZE=4

Facilities ticket — Halewick Tower, night shift.

Issue: support team reporting east stairwell reader rejecting badges after midnight. Reader was reset this morning; firmware updated. Overnight crew should now badge as normal. If the reader fails again, use the manual keypad by the fire door — do not prop the door. Log any further failures with the time and badge name. Temporary keypad code for the fallback door is below.

door code, tajeg-fawip: bdg-K-62